A great, cozy place for breakfast outside the village area of Skaneatleles. Good specials and made to order food. Friendley staff and hometown feel. We went twice while in the area. This Cafe is very popular , so parties larger than six may have to wait or split up for seating.

Sweet little place. Awesome tomato soup and homemade coconut cream pie were the stars today. Our waitress, Jen, is a gem. Closes at 1pn until after Easter and then at 2pm BUT Fridays until 8pm for fish fry.
